Liverpool continued their impressive Premier League campaign with a resounding 4-1 win over Ipswich Town at Anfield on Saturday. Goals from Dominik Szoboszlai, Mohamed Salah, and a brace by Cody Gakpo secured the victory, further consolidating the Reds’ position at the top of the league table. Head coach Arne Slot lauded his team’s “almost perfect” performance, praising their dominance, defensive discipline, and attacking prowess.

A Fast Start Sets the Tone
Slot highlighted the importance of Liverpool’s early goal in establishing control over the game. He noted that previous home matches had seen the Reds concede early, forcing them to chase the game. However, Saturday’s match offered a contrasting narrative.
“Yeah, that’s mostly because we scored an early goal,” Slot said. “It’s been a few times now that we played a home game that we conceded a goal in the start of the game, but I think today is the way you want to start the game: we were aggressive, dominant.”
The early goal not only energized the team but also disrupted Ipswich’s defensive setup. Slot’s emphasis on aggression and dominance underscores the tactical approach Liverpool adopted, ensuring that Ipswich remained pinned in their own half for most of the match.
Dominance Across the Pitch
Liverpool’s control of the game was evident in their ability to neutralize Ipswich’s counter-attacking threats. With wingers capable of exploiting space and a strong No. 9 in Liam Delap, Ipswich posed potential dangers. However, the Reds’ disciplined approach ensured they kept these threats at bay.
“For 85 minutes, they have hardly been in our half, I think,” Slot remarked. “It is a counter-attack threat with the wingers they have and with Delap, but we managed to control that so, so, so well because of the amount of work we have put in.”
This control was achieved through relentless pressing, positional awareness, and a cohesive defensive structure. The lone blemish on an otherwise impeccable display was conceding a goal from a corner—the first such instance this season. Despite this, Slot’s assessment of the team’s performance as “almost perfect” reflects his satisfaction with their overall execution.
Mohamed Salah’s All-Round Contribution
While Salah is often celebrated for his goal-scoring exploits, Slot highlighted the Egyptian forward’s defensive work-rate as a key moment in the match. Salah’s decision to chase back and prevent a counter-attack epitomized the team’s commitment to both attacking and defensive responsibilities.
“It’s also nice that you come up with it because mostly about Mo it’s about his contract or about his goals, and now it’s about his defensive work-rate,” Slot noted. “That stood out because it was a moment we could all see.”
Salah’s contribution reflects the broader ethos Slot has instilled in the team—a willingness to work tirelessly off the ball to maintain control and thwart opposition threats. Such moments not only inspire teammates but also set the standard for collective effort.
Dominik Szoboszlai’s Growing Influence
Dominik Szoboszlai’s performance was another highlight of the match. The Hungarian midfielder opened the scoring with a well-taken goal, showcasing his ability to make decisive contributions in the final third. Slot praised Szoboszlai’s evolution, noting his increased willingness to take responsibility in attacking situations.
“At the beginning of the season, he would have played that ball to Mo,” Slot observed. “And now he decided to go for the goal himself and scored the goal himself.”

Virgil van Dijk: The Quintessential Leader
Saturday’s match marked Virgil van Dijk’s 300th appearance for Liverpool—a milestone that Slot used to underscore the Dutch defender’s immense contributions to the team. Van Dijk’s leadership, composure, and defensive prowess were all on display as he marshaled the backline with characteristic authority.
“If I have to make a list of what Virgil brings to this team then we can just go to the next press conference on Tuesday evening against PSV because he brings so many positives to this team,” Slot said.

Endo’s Resilience and Mentality
Wataru Endo’s involvement in a physical challenge with Julio Enciso briefly raised concerns, but the midfielder’s resilience shone through. Slot admitted to initial fears about the severity of the incident but was reassured by Endo’s quick recovery.
“Yes, when the foul was made I was like, that doesn’t look good,” Slot said. “But immediately during the game already he shakes his head one or two times and just goes again. His mentality is unbelievable.”
Endo’s toughness and determination exemplify the attributes Slot values in his players. These qualities are crucial in maintaining Liverpool’s competitive edge in a physically demanding league.
